/* Main CSS */
body {
background-image: url(http://www.hdwallpapers.org/walls/google-abstract-HD.jpg);
margin: 0;
font-size: 13px;
line-height: 20px;
color: #222222;
word-wrap: break-word;
-webkit-touch-callout: none;
-webkit-user-select: none; 
-moz-user-select: none; 
-ms-user-select: none; 
-o-user-select: none;
user-select: none;
}

.hidden {
display: none;
}

.ccbv {
margin: 5px;
padding: 5px;
border-left: 5px solid #FCE27C;
background: #fff6d4;
}

.loading {
    background: #d3d3d3; background: rgba(0, 0, 0, 0.30);
	filter: alpha(opacity = 30); -moz-border-radius: 4px; -webkit-border-radius: 4px; border-radius: 4px; -moz-background-clip: padding; -webkit-background-clip: padding-box; background-clip: padding-box; font-family: Tahoma; font-size: 12px; width:200px; left:50%; top:50%; margin-left:-100px; margin-top:-33px; color:#FFF; text-align:center; padding:10px; position: fixed; 
}

.list1{background-color: #f5f5f5;border-top: 1px solid #fff;border-bottom: 1px solid #cacaca;margin: 0;padding: 4px;}

.list2  {background-color: #ebebeb;border-top: 1px solid #fff;border-bottom: 1px solid #cacaca;margin: 0;padding: 4px;}

.list1 a:link ,.list1 a:visited ,.list2 a:link ,.list2 a:visited {
  color:#3366FF;text-decoration: none;}

.list1 a:hover ,.list2 a:hover {color: #D15D34;text-decoration: underline;}

.status {
color:#CD853F;
}

.white {background-color:#ffffff;padding: 2px;}

.topmenu {
background-color:#F2F6F8;
border-bottom:1px solid #EBEBEB;
border-left:1px solid #C6C4C4;
border-right:1px solid #C6C4C4;
color:#34617E;
margin:0;
padding:4px;
}

textarea, input[type="text"], input[type="password"] {
max-width: 95%;
width: 95%;
}

input[type="submit"] {
background: #86C219 50% top repeat-x;
color:#fff;
padding:2px 4px 2px 4px;
border:1px solid #8fdcff;
}
input[type="submit"]:hover {
color:#000;
background:#009900 0 top repeat-x;
border:1px solid #000;
padding:2px 4px 2px 4px;
}

.rmenu {
background-color: #e9ccd2;
border: 1px solid white;
margin: 0;
padding: 2px 0 3px 4px;
}

.unread {
background-color: #e4e6fd;
font-size: 11px;
padding: 4px;
margin: 1px 0px 4px 0px;
border: 1px solid #afbbd7;
box-shadow: 0px 1px 1px #ccc;
-moz-box-shadow: 0px 1px 1px #ccc;
-webkit-box-shadow: 0px 1px 1px #ccc;
}

img {
max-width: 90%;
}

object {
max-width: 100%;
}

button {
display: inline;
background: #86C219 50% top repeat-x;
color:#fff;
padding:2px 4px 2px 4px;
border:1px solid #8fdcff;
}

button:hover {
color:#000;
background:#009900 0 top repeat-x;
border:1px solid #000;
padding:2px 4px 2px 4px;
display: inline;
}

small.alert {
  background: #ff5c5c repeat-x top left;
  font-weight: bold;
  padding: 1px 3px 1px 3px;
   color: #fff;
  border: 1px solid #f88;
  border-radius: 3px;
  -moz-border-radius: 3px;
  -webkit-border-radius: 3px;
white-space: nowrap;
}

.topmenu h1 {
font-size: 15px;
margin: 3px 5px;
}

input[type="text"], select {
max-width: 95%;
}

textarea, input[type="file"] {
width: 95%;
}

.edit {
background-color: #ebebeb; 
border-top: 1px solid #fff;
border-bottom: 1px solid #cacaca;
margin: 0;
padding: 4px;
}
canvas {
max-width: 100%;
}

/* Attachment CSS */
.file-attach {
background-color: #fff7eb;
border: 1px solid #f9d9b0;
border-radius: 5px;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
margin: 6px 2px 2px 3px;
padding: 0;
max-width: 360px;
}
.file-attach .attach {
background: #fadeba repeat-x top left;
font-weight: bold;
margin: 0;
padding: 2px 4px 2px 2px;
border-bottom: 1px solid #f9bc6d;
border-top-left-radius: 4px;
-webkit-border-top-left-radius: 4px;
-moz-border-radius-topleft: 4px;
border-top-right-radius: 4px;
-webkit-border-top-right-radius: 4px;
-moz-border-radius-topright: 4px;
}
.menu {
background-color: #ebebeb;
border: 1px solid white;
margin: 0;
padding: 3px 4px 3px 4px;
}

/* Quote CSS */
.quote {
border-left: 4px solid #c0c0c0;
color: #878787;
font-size: x-small;
margin-left: 2px;
margin-bottom: 4px;
padding: 2px 0 2px 4px;
}
.mod-quote {
background-color: #f5fafd;
border: 1px solid #d7edfc;
border-radius: 5px;
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
margin: 6px 2px 2px 3px;
padding: 0;
max-width: 640px;
}
.mod-quote .author {
background: #dbeffc repeat-x top left;
margin: 0;
padding: 2px 4px 2px 2px;
border-bottom: 1px solid #a5cae4;
border-top-left-radius: 4px;
-webkit-border-top-left-radius: 4px;
-moz-border-radius-topleft: 4px;
border-top-right-radius: 4px;
-webkit-border-top-right-radius: 4px;
-moz-border-radius-topright: 4px;
}

/* Comment CSS */
.content {
background-color: #fff;
padding: 4px 4px 8px 4px;
margin: 4px 0px 4px 0px;
border: 1px solid #afbbd7;
box-shadow: 0px 1px 1px #ccc;
-moz-box-shadow: 0px 1px 1px #ccc;
-webkit-box-shadow: 0px 1px 1px #ccc;
}
.content .memInfo {
background-color: #e4f3fd;
border-bottom: 1px dotted #c8e9ff;
margin: -4px -4px 0 -4px;
padding: 2px;
}
.timePost {
border-bottom: 1px dotted #c8e9ff;
padding: 2px;
font-size: 10px;
color: gray;
margin-bottom: 6px;
}
a.like {
margin-top: 18px;
background-color: #e4f3fd;
font-size: 11px;
color: blue;
padding: 1px 2px 1px 2px;
border: 1px solid #c8e9ff;
}
.content .memInfo .avatar {
background: #ffffff;
margin: 0px 10px;
padding: 2px;
border: 1px solid #ccc;
border-radius:30px;
}
.content .memInfo .avatar:hover {
-moz-box-shadow:0 0 10px #666;
-webkit-box-shadow:0 0 10px #666;
border-radius:5px;
background-color:#ffffff;
transition:all 2s ease;
-webkit-transition:all 2s ease;
-moz-transition:all 2s ease;
transform:rotate(360deg);
-moz-transform:rotate(360deg);
-webkit-transform:rotate(360deg);
position:relative;
padding: 5px;
}

/* Pagination CSS */
.paging, .xt_pagination {
padding: 5px;
background: #fff;
border: 1px solid #ddd;
}
.currentpage, .xt_pagination span.selected, .paging span {
background: #009900;
color: #FFF;
margin: 2px 2px;
display: inline-block;
border-radius: 4px;
padding: 2px 6px;
}
.paging a, .xt_pagination a, .currentpage a {
background: #7DCF2C;
color: #FFF;
margin: 2px 2px;
display: inline-block;
border-radius: 4px;
padding: 2px 6px;
}
.paging a:hover, .xt_pagination a:hover, .currentpage a:hover {
 background: #009900;
}

/* Prefix CSS */

.label-1{background-color:#F89406;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-2{background-color:#3A87AD;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-3{background-color:#B94A48;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-4{background-color:#CD0000;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-5{background-color:#093;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-6{background-color:#999999;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-7{background-color:#009933;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.label-0{background-color:#FF8C00;border-radius:3px;color:#FFF;font-size:11.844px;font-weight:700;line-height:14px;text-shadow:0 -1px 0 rgba(0,0,0,0.25);vertical-align:baseline;white-space:nowrap;padding:1px 4px 2px;}

.bbcode_code {
background-color: #E0E6E9;
border: 1px dotted #9FAEBB;
margin-top: 4px;
padding: 0 2px 0 2px;
overflow: auto;
}

.content .image {
padding: 1px;    
    border: 0px solid #d5d5d5;
    border-radius: 2px;
}

.content .image:hover {
    box-shadow: 0px 0px 10px #666;
    -moz-box-shadow: 0px 0px 10px #666;
    -webkit-box-shadow: 0px 0px 10px #666;
    border-radius: 5px;
}

.list-group-item, .list , .list1, .menu{
	border-bottom:1px dotted #ddd;
	padding:4px;
}

.logo2{background:url(http://vnmaster.yn.lt/css/img/bg-header.png) green;
text-align: center;
}

.logo2 a{color:#fff !important;
	font-weight:bold;}

.logo{background:url(http://vnmaster.yn.lt/img/may.png) #99d6f9;
text-align: center;
}

.logo a{color:#fff !important;
	font-weight:bold;}

p{font-size:14px;display:inline;margin-bottom:6px;margin-top:6px;}

.note{background:url(http://cdn.mobiviet.vn/theme/default/images/note.png) repeat-x scroll left top #FF5C5C;font-weight:700;color:#FFF;border:1px solid #F88;border-radius:3px;padding:1px 3px;}

.hdr {background-color: #f1f1f1;border-bottom: 1px solid #595959;font-weight: bold;padding-left: 2px;}
.share{margin: 1px; padding: 2px 4px 2px 4px;
}
.share:hover{opacity: .8;}
.fb{background: #0062BD; padding: 4px; border-radius: 2px;text-align:center;}
.gg{background: #CE1919;padding: 4px; border-radius: 2px;text-align:center;}
.tw{background: #0097DF;padding: 4px; border-radius: 2px;text-align:center;}